tudammiru kulla shayʾin bi-ʾamri rabbihā fa-ʾaṣbaḥū yurā ʾillā masākinuhum ka-dhālika najzī l-qawma l-mujrimīna

destroying everything by its Lord’s command.’ So they became such that nothing could be seen except their dwellings. Thus do We requite the guilty lot.

Ali Quli Qarai

"Everything will it destroy by the command of its Lord!" Then by the morning they - nothing was to be seen but (the ruins of) their houses! thus do We recompense those given to sin!
